Transaction 856a795263acd5ac0d2c2a29d9a914341d86cbce61f283c02ba519c580074738
1 Input
1 Output
-
856a795263acd5ac0d2c2a29d9a914341d86cbce61f283c02ba519c580074738:0
- value
- 134708
- script pubkey
- OP_0 OP_PUSHBYTES_20 edd25406318c32f456c898f06e255acadc1a1e48
- address
- bc1qahf9gp333se0g4kgnrcxuf26etwp58jg68xjqs